The Problem Every Project Faces
Construction and infrastructure projects fail — and they fail expensively — not because problems do not exist, but because those problems are not detected early enough. A hairline crack that costs £200 to repair in week three costs £20,000 to remediate in week thirty. A misaligned structural element that a camera would catch in seconds takes a physical site visit to find — and only if the right person happens to be looking in the right place at the right time.
The fundamental challenge is that the human eye, deployed infrequently through scheduled inspections, is not sufficient to monitor the complexity and pace of a modern construction site. Visual Intelligence was built to change that.

Why Visual Intelligence?
The case for AI-powered visual monitoring is straightforward: the cost of detection rises exponentially the longer a defect goes unnoticed. Visual Intelligence inverts that curve — delivering continuous, automated monitoring at a fraction of the cost of manual inspection programmes, while building a complete evidential record that protects every stakeholder in the project.
Visual Intelligence does not require your teams to change how they work. Engineers who already capture site photographs continue to do so — the AI processes those images automatically, flags anomalies, and generates structured reports without adding to anyone's workload. Monitoring becomes a by-product of documentation that was already happening, rather than a separate programme that competes for time and budget.
